One of the causes of acne can be tap water
If we cannot determine the cause of the sudden appearance of pimples, we may also consider tap water as a major risk factor. Dermatologists explain that tap water can be "harsh" to the skin. The reason is that it dries out the skin, which can lead to inflammation. As a result, acne appears.
To a large extent, this risk depends on the type of water, as well as the sensitivity of the skin. For example, if we suffer from eczema and rosacea, tap water can cause more irritation than someone who is not affected by a similar skin problem.
